- Uses
AC Sealer may be used on any interior wood surface where a high performance, high solids, moisture, water and chemical resistant finishing system is needed. AC Sealer is much more durable and moisture resistant than conventional nitrocellulose or vinyl sealers with added benefits of easy application, quick drying, high solids and build.
- Application
Application Procedure
AC Sealer is formulated to be ready to spray after catalyzation, and has excellent sanding between coats (use no-fill type sandpaper). Never use more than two coats of AC Sealer or apply a complete coating system of over 5 dry mils as film integrity may be effected. Always sand white wood (unfinished) with no more than 140 grit sandpaper before application of AC Sealer. Catalyzed (cross-linked) coatings develop extremely durable finishes, but require controlled application procedures. Do not apply material in too heavy a film (4 to 5 mils wet are recommended). Too much coating weight can cause recoating and durability problems. A light (scuff) sanding between coats is always necessary. An excellent, very durable sealer coat can be obtained by applying just one coat of AC Sealer (apply no more than two coats). Recommended total finish system dry mil thickness should not exceed 5 mils dry. Always thoroughly agitate during application.
Note: Hot spray application is not recommended. If hot spray equipment is used, temperature setting should never be over 110°F.
Mixing
AC Sealer has been designed to start its cross-linking (drying) with the addition of 10% (12.8 ounces per gallon) of M.L. Campbell C1491 Care Catalyst. Always mix catalyst in thoroughly before application. No waiting time is necessary before using catalyzed product. After catalyzation, AC Sealer has best performance properties if used before 4 hours.

Surface Preparation
- New Work: Remove any dirt, grease or other construction contamination and sand wood as required. If desired, use M.L. Campbell WoodSong II stains or Microtone dyes.
- Old Work: Strip old finishes completely and remove all contaminants from surface. When surface is dry, sand as required. Finish as new work. If cratering develops on old work, Fish Eye Killer may remedy this problem, if the contamination is not severe.
Reduction
M.L. Campbell AC Sealer is shipped at spraying consistency (approx. 24-27 seconds in a Ford #4 Cup). If further reduction is necessary, use M.L. Campbell C16036 Standard Lacquer Thinner.

Properties
- Physical Properties
- Typical Properties
Value | Units | Test Method / Conditions | |
Weight Per Gallon | 7.75 - 8.35 | lbs/gal | - |
Viscosity (Ford #4 At 77°F) | 24 - 27 | sec | - |
Solids by Weight | 30 - 34 | % | - |
Solids by Volume | 23 - 27 | % | - |
Theoretical Coverage (At 1 Mil Dry) | 400 - 420 | sq. ft. per gallon | - |
Flash Point | 50.0 | °F | PMCC |
Packaged VOC | 636.0 | g/l | - |
Packaged VOC (Catalyzed at 10%) | 646.0 | g/l | - |
Photochemically Reactive | Yes | - | - |
Value | Units | Test Method / Conditions | |
Dry to Touch (At 77°F) | 15 - 25 | minutes | - |
Sanding Dry (At 77°F) | 15 - 30 | minutes | - |
Stacking Dry (At 77°F) | 12.0 | hours | - |
